WOODRIVER CELLARS’ “PERFECT PAIR” NIGHT TO FEATURE WILD GAME IN SEPTEMBER

Eagle Hills Golf Course’s “Eighteen 1” Restaurant Chef Aaron Horsewood to Be Featured as Woodriver Cellars’ First Perfect Pair Guest Chef

Eagle, Idaho, September 8, 2009 – A very special “Perfect Pair” food and wine event will be held at Woodriver Cellars (www.woodrivercellars.com) this Thursday, September 10th at 7:00 pm. With the arrival of hunting season, the popular Perfect Pair event will feature wild game paired with Woodriver Cellars’ amazing Port and its 2005 Cabernet Sauvignon. Guest Chef Aaron Horsewood of “Eighteen 1” restaurant will prepare fresh, local wild game in a variety of Tapas-style dishes while Woodriver Cellars winemaker Neil Glancey will host the event. Glancey and Horsewood will be talking to guests and answering questions in what should be an interactive evening of food, wine and fun. Chef Aaron is the first ever in a planned series of “guest” chefs that will make an appearance at the winery’s monthly food/wine evening.

About Woodriver Cellars

Woodriver Cellars is the best kept secret among Idaho’s fine wineries. Named after the much acclaimed Woodriver Vineyard, which the company purchased in 2008, Woodriver Cellars uses environmentally sustainable practices and has gained a reputation for creating unique, award-winning wines from the best grapes in Idaho. Located at an optimal 2,200 feet elevation at the heart of the Snake River Appellation, the Woodriver Vineyard has a history of producing outstanding grapes. In fact, the vineyard has contributed towards other wineries winning awards for over 15 years. Celebrated winemaker Neil Glancey takes advantage of Woodriver Vineyard’s optimal rocky, Bordeaux-like soil and purposefully limits harvests to two tons per acre to produce memorable wines with intense fruit flavors that stay in the minds of wine lovers long after they have finished a bottle. Based on its limited wine production, Woodriver Cellars award-winning wines are available only at select restaurants, boutique wine shops and the Woodriver Cellars winery. Woodriver Cellars’ wines have won numerous awards at renowned wine tasting competitions, such as the San Francisco Chronicle Wine Competition, the West Coast Wine Competition, the Idaho Wine Festival and the Finger Lakes International Wine Competition in New York.
